OSX00070 - Disable Audio Recording Support Software - 'AppleUSBAudio.kext'

Information

Your computer might be in an environment where recording devices such as cameras
or microphones are not permitted. You can protect your organization's privacy by
disabling these devices. Remove support for the microphone and audio subsystem. This may disable audio playback. Important- Repeat these instructions every time a system update is installed.

Solution

Open a terminal session and enter the following commands to remove the files-
sudo srm -rf /System/Library/Extensions/AppleOnboardAudio.kext
sudo srm -rf /System/Library/Extensions/AppleUSBAudio.kext
sudo srm -rf /System/Library/Extensions/AppleDeviceTreeUpdater.kext
sudo srm -rf /System/Library/Extensions/IOAudioFamily.kext
sudo srm -rf /System/Library/Extensions/VirtualAudioDriver.kext
sudo touch /System/Library/Extensions GUI Procedures- 1. Open the /System/Library/Extensions folder.
2. To remove support for audio components such as the microphone, drag the following files to the Trash- AppleOnboardAudio.kext, AppleUSBAudio.kext, AudioDeviceTreeUpdater.kext, IOAudioFamily.kext, and VirtualAudioDriver.kext
3. Open Terminal and enter the following command- $ sudo touch System/Library/Extensions The touch command changes the modified date of the /System/Library/Extensions folder. When the folder has a new modified date, the Extension cache files (located in /System/Library/) are deleted and rebuilt by Mac OS X.
4. Choose Finder -> Secure Empty Trash to delete the file.
5. Restart the system.

See Also

http://iase.disa.mil/stigs/os/mac/u_mac_osx10.5_v1r2_stig_20110729.zip

Item Details

Category: CONFIGURATION MANAGEMENT

References: 800-53|CM-7, CAT|II, CSCv6|9.1, Rule-ID|SV-31303r1_rule, STIG-ID|OSX00070, Vuln-ID|V-25254

Plugin: Unix

Control ID: 25e8dadc7a65328b870f594cee59bbd49b28593d0615f2433727b8b3147524ac